The news have been waiting for has now broken.
Roy Hodgson has been announced as the new Liverpool manager, signing a three-year deal at Anfield. Liverpool will be holding a press conference with Hodgson later on. Fulham will reportedly receive £2.5m in comepnsation.
There’s now a massive void at Fulham and let’s hope it is filled by someone who can continue to move the club forward.
Goodbye Roy – and all the best.
